By Richard Jeffrey F Ocampo (XUHS Athletics Coordinator)

Xavier University - Ateneo de Cagayan High School Crusaders football boys’ varsity team went toe-to-toe with the best teams in the city and region, specifically in the 18-and-under category, in the recent Magis Football Club Fiesta Cup 2017 held at the Westridge Sports Park on July 15 and 16.

The boys swept through the elimination round, defeating teams from Corpus Christi, Salay National High School, and Rosevale.

In the quarterfinals, their mettle was tested by the Team A of the Central Mindanao University (CMU). After the regulation has ended, the Xavier Ateneo team managed to rack up more goals during the penalty shoot-out against their tough opponent, winning with a score of 4 against 2; XUHS won over CMU.

During the semifinals, the Crusaders were able to overcome another “cardiac-arrest” game. Prevailing over powerhouse Rosevale football team to the tune of 4 against 3 in the shootout, the Crusaders football boys then advanced into the finals.

However, they fell short in the campaign as they battled against the Holy Cross team, reputed as one of the best teams in the region, as known in the football community in Mindanao.

The XUHS Crusaders won the second place at the conclusion of Fiesta Football Cup 2017.∎
